Summary
make:event --broadcastnow scaffolds a broadcasting event (implementingBroadcastOn,BroadcastAs,BroadcastWith, andBroadcastWhen), and--broadcast --nowadditionally scaffoldsBroadcastNowreturningtrue; both are covered by new feature tests.[]stringinstead of the removedcontracts.Channelstruct.v1.18.1-0.20260805080351-d2e95f66f306pseudo-version containing framework#1532 (make:eventbroadcast/now flags and the broadcasting channel refactor).Why
Framework PR goravel/framework#1532 adds
--broadcastand--broadcast --nowflags to themake:eventcommand and replaces thebroadcasting.Channelstruct with plain[]stringchannels. The example repository must stay in sync with that API so the generated events compile and demonstrate the new scaffolding.The example's broadcast events now return
[]stringchannels, and the event feature suite gains coverage for both new command flags, verifying the scaffolded file contents (broadcast methods present, listener-only methods absent, andBroadcastNowreturningtrueonly for the--nowvariant).
